Doutzen Kroes (born January 23, 1985 in Friesland, The Netherlands) is a Dutch supermodel.
She has graced the covers of Time, Vogue, Harper's Bazaar, and Numero, appeared in the Victoria's Secret Fashion Show in 2005 and 2006, and was named in August 2005 as the replacement for Christy Turlington in the Calvin Klein "eternity" fragrance campaign. She is regularly featured in the Victoria's Secret catalog, and in the Gucci, Calvin Klein, Tommy Hilfiger, Escada, Dolce & Gabbana, Valentino, Versace and Neiman Marcus campaigns. Doutzen has also appeared on the catwalk and is in high demand for many prestigious designers. She is represented by YES Models and Paparazzi. [citation needed]
In 2005, she was selected as Model of The Year on Vogue.com by readers.
In April 2006, Doutzen signed a three-year contract with cosmetics company L'Oréal Paris.
In 2007 Doutzen started a relationship with renowned skater, and fellow Frisian, Sven Kramer.
